LIFT ARM CONTROL LEVER
This lever (6) is used to operate the lift arm.
NOTICE
Do not use the FLOAT position when lowering the bucket. Use the FLOAT
position when leveling, see "LEVELING OPERATIONS (PAGE 3-145)".
Position (a): RAISE
When the lift arm control lever is pulled further from
the RAISE position, the lever is stopped in this
position until the lift arm reaches the preset position of
the kickout, and the lever is returned to the HOLD
position.
Position (b): HOLD
The lift arm is kept in the same position.
Position (c): LOWER
Position (d): FLOAT
The lift arm moves freely under external force.
BRAKE PEDAL
WARNING
When traveling downhill, always use the right brake pedal, and use the
braking force of the engine together with the brake.
Do not use the brake pedal repeatedly more than necessary. If the brake
is used too frequently, the brake will overheat. If this happens, the
brakes will not work, so this may lead to a serious accident.
Do not put your foot on this pedal unless necessary.
These pedals (7) operate the brakes.
RIGHT AND LEFT BRAKE PEDAL
The right brake pedal operates the wheel brakes.
Use the right brake pedal for normal braking operations.
When the transmission cut-off switch is at the ON position, the brakes are applied, and the transmission is returned
to Neutral at the same time.
When the transmission cut-off switch is at the OFF position, the brakes are applied, but the transmission is not
returned to Neutral.
REMARK
When using the brake and accelerator together to reduce the machine travel speed or to stop the machine while
carrying out operations, set the transmission cut-off switch to the ON position and use the brake pedal.
